To give some background, I’m 21 and decided last year i wanted to get into the hobby so i did all my research and eventually set up a biocube 32 in october of 2020. The tank ran great for about 7 months, I had a pair of clowns, a royal gramma, a coral beauty amongst a cleaner shrimp, handfull of snails and a gsp frag. About 7 months into the tank running i started noticing dinos popping up on the sand bed and rocks. I did loads of research on here and youtube on ways to battle them knowing that they can get out of hand quick. First i tried the Dr tims method using the waste away and blacoout etc. That didn’t work so then i started dosing neonitro and neophos because the levels were down in the tank and i know that is a direct cause of dinos forming. I did this for weeks while checking my parameters every other day and saw no improvement. Its been a few months since the issue began and the tank is seemingly overrun by the dinos and i dont know what to do.
